Transaction 106cb6fda33ce5438fd3f65c39128b33c721e7e35be05dcc1e76d32dd952ec27
1 Input
1 Output
-
106cb6fda33ce5438fd3f65c39128b33c721e7e35be05dcc1e76d32dd952ec27:0
- value
- 8586696
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4fb277363ed3ddafd14060f89c9503ec86e6e28f OP_EQUALVERIFY OP_CHECKSIG
- address
- 18GQBAgGCfDw85HMabvP1ZqxiJJpfXABYG